How KPIs Drive Food Delivery Profitability


For any enterprise, knowing its performance metrics is crucial to maintaining profitability. In the food delivery industry, KPIs such as delivery time, order accuracy, and user happiness are critical. Tracking and improving these KPIs allows delivery services to offer a better customer experience. Moreover, keeping an eye on profitability helps companies optimize operations, reduce charges, and increase overall efficiency.

The Impact of the Pandemic on Food Delivery Services


The global health crisis has had a substantial impact on the delivery services, boosting its growth as consumers turned to delivery services due to social distancing measures. The shift has emphasized the importance of digital transformation in the food industry, with restaurants quickly adopting online food See More ordering and delivery apps. As the world adapts to new normals, delivery services must continue innovating to satisfy changing consumer demands and ensure market expansion.
